MEXICAN CHORIZO STRATA



Mexican Chorizo Strata image

Provided by Rachael Ray : Food Network

Categories     main-dish

Time 9h25m

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 15

EVOO or vegetable oil
1 pound fresh Mexican chorizo or other spicy bulk sausage
7 to 8 slices (1-inch thick) good-quality stale white or egg-based bread, cut into large cubes
3 roasted green New Mexico chile peppers or 2 poblano or Anaheim peppers, peeled, seeded and chopped, or two 4-ounce cans chopped green chilies, well drained
2 cups whole milk
1 stick (8 tablespoons) butter, melted and cooled
1 tablespoon hot sauce
6 large organic eggs
Kosher salt and freshly ground pepper
2 1/2 cups shredded sharp Cheddar
1 cup sour cream
1 ripe avocado, pitted and peeled
Juice of 1 lime
Diced ripe heirloom tomato, for serving
Fresh cilantro leaves, torn, for serving

Steps:

  • Heat a drizzle of EVOO in a skillet. Add the chorizo and cook, crumbling with a wooden spoon, until browned. Drain off the fat.
  • Arrange the bread in a casserole dish. Top with the chorizo and then the roasted chiles.
  • Whisk together the milk, butter, hot sauce and eggs in a bowl and sprinkle with salt and pepper; pour over the chiles. Top with the cheese. Cover and refrigerate at least overnight and up to 2 days.
  • To serve, bring the strata to room temperature and preheat the oven to 325 degrees F. Bake the strata for 1 hour.
  • Meanwhile, whizz together the sour cream, avocado and lime juice in a food processor and season with salt and pepper.
  • Top the strata with tomatoes, cilantro and dollops of the avocado sour cream.

MEXICAN SAUSAGE STRATA



Mexican Sausage Strata image

Good for breakfast or supper. From BHG with changes. (Time to prepare doesn't include refrigeration).

Provided by Caroline Cooks

Categories     Breakfast

Time 53m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

5 slices bread (white or whole wheat,cubed)
6 ounces ground sausage, country blend
3 eggs
1 cup milk
1/2 cup light sour cream
1/2 cup shredded monterey jack pepper cheese
1/3 cup shredded sharp cheddar cheese
1/3 cup salsa

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 325°F.
  • Coat a 9-inch quiche dish with nonstick cooking spray.
  • Spread bread cubes evenly in quiche dish. Set aside.
  • Crumble sausage into a medium skillet; cook until brown.
  • Drain off fat.
  • Pat with paper toweling to remove excess fat.
  • Sprinkle cooked sausage over bread cubes in quiche dish.
  • In a medium mixing bowl, beat together eggs, milk, and sour cream.
  • Stir in cheeses.
  • Pour egg mixture over sausage in quiche dish.
  • Cover and refrigerate for at least 2 hours. Uncover and bake for 35-40 minutes or until center is set and top is golden brown. Remove from oven.
  • Let stand for 5-10 minutes before cutting. To serve, cut strata into wedges. Spoon some salsa on top of each serving.

MEXICAN SAUSAGE & CORNBREAD STRATA



Mexican Sausage & Cornbread Strata image

The beauty of my Mexican strata is that you can change it depending on the veggies you have on hand. I make mine most often with corn and pico de gallo. -Lisa Huff, Wilton, Connecticut

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Breakfast     Brunch

Time 1h15m

Yield 10 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 pound fresh chorizo
1 medium onion, finely chopped
1 cup frozen corn, thawed
1 cup pico de gallo, drained
8 cups coarsely crumbled cornbread
8 large eggs
2 cups 2% milk
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
1/8 teaspoon pepper
1 cup shredded Mexican cheese blend

Steps:

  • In a large skillet, cook chorizo and onion over medium-high heat 5-7 minutes or until chorizo is cooked through, breaking into crumbles; drain. In a large bowl combine chorizo mixture, corn and pico de gallo; fold in cornbread. Transfer to a greased 13x9-in. baking dish. , In another large bowl, whisk eggs, milk, salt, garlic powder and pepper; pour over cornbread mixture., Refrigerate, covered, several hours or overnight. , Preheat oven to 350°. Remove strata from refrigerator while oven heats. Bake, uncovered, 45 minutes or until golden brown and center is set. Sprinkle with cheese. Bake 5-8 minutes longer or until cheese is melted., Let stand 10 minutes before serving.

MEXICAN CHORIZO STRATA



Mexican Chorizo Strata image

Make and share this Mexican Chorizo Strata recipe from Food.com.

Provided by Pinay0618

Categories     Breakfast

Time 13h30m

Yield 4-6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 15

extra virgin olive oil or vegetable oil
1 lb fresh mexican chorizo sausage or 1 lb other spicy bulk sausage
8 slices day-old white bread or 8 slices egg-based bread, cut into large cubes
2 anaheim chilies, peeled, seeded and chopped or chopped green chili, well drained
2 cups whole milk
1/2 cup butter, melted and cooled (8 tablespoons)
1 tablespoon hot sauce
6 large organic eggs
kosher salt & freshly ground black pepper
2 1/2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ese
1 cup sour cream
1 ripe avocado, pitted and peeled
1 lime, juice of
diced ripe heirloom tomato, for serving
fresh cilantro leaves, torn, for serving

Steps:

  • To roast the chili peppers, broil, turning occasionally with tongs and leaving the oven door ajar to allow steam to escape, until the skins are blackened all over. Transfer to a bowl, cover and let cool. Peel, seed and chop.
  • Heat a drizzle of olive oil in a skillet. Add the chorizo and cook, crumbling with a wooden spoon, until browned. Drain off the fat.
  • Arrange the bread in a casserole dish. Top with the chorizo and then the roasted chilies.
  • Whisk together the milk, butter, hot sauce and eggs in a bowl and sprinkle with salt and pepper; pour over the chili peppers. Top with the cheese. Cover and refrigerate at least overnight and up to 2 days.
  • To serve, bring the strata to room temperature and pre-heat the oven to 325°F Bake the strata for 1 hour.
  • Meanwhile, whizz together the sour cream, avocado and lime juice in a food processor and season with salt and pepper.
  • Top the strata with tomatoes, cilantro and dollops of the avocado sour cream.
